New burial trenches have appeared in Mariupol: mortality among citizens is increasing

New burial trenches have been recorded in temporarily occupied Mariupol, which is associated with the exhumation of bodies and the increase in mortality among the civilian population. Local authorities and the Center for the Study of the Occupation report a shocking scale of new burials in the third year of the occupation.

New burial trenches have been recorded in temporarily occupied Mariupol. This is reported by the Mariupol City Council and the head of the Center for the Study of the Occupation, Petro Andryuschenko.

This is associated with the exhumation of bodies that were buried during or after the Russian blockade of the city, as well as with the increase in mortality among the civilian population during the occupation.

As Andryuschenko noted, the scale of new burial trenches is shocking in the third year of the occupation. At the same time, the mortality rate continues to grow.

According to the city council, at least 22,000 civilians died during the 86 days of the Russian blockade of Mariupol. However, these losses may be many times higher, as the Russian authorities are hiding the true number of deaths, as well as the war crimes they committed during the encirclement, bombing, and occupation of the city.
